Nofisat Ayantola

Academic qualifications

PhD in Retail and Marketing, MSc, BSc (Hons)

"A personal point of pride is completing my PhD in Retail and Marketing, which, combined with my past experience as a Project Manager, allows me to blend theory and real-world insights in my teaching."

I’m passionate about exploring how technology transforms consumer experiences and business strategies. In my teaching role, my goal is to inspire students to think critically and creatively in the digital space, with a special emphasis on the impact marketing can have on small businesses and how digital tools empower them to forge meaningful relationships with their customers and co-create value. I enjoy sharing my passion for marketing and witnessing my students grow in confidence, think critically, and apply creative strategies to solve real-world challenges.

I teach a wide range of Higher Education courses, including International Marketing, International Digital Marketing, Digital Innovation, SEO and Digital Marketing, Digital Marketing and Campaign Planning, and Foundations of Content Production. Before entering academia, I worked as a Project Manager, gaining valuable experience in planning, coordination, and stakeholder engagement. This practical background enables me to bring real-world insights into the classroom, blending theory and practice to support students in developing industry-relevant skills.
